The $20,000 Jesuit Breakfast

It’s been called the $20,000 breakfast, at least that’s what we’d heard.
After scrimping and saving and tweaking our budget, we had come up with the $5,000 per year tuition to send our son to St. Paul’s High School, a Jesuit educational institution.
On the Friday before Mother’s Day of the graduation year, moms are treated to a morning of celebration. Although it was quite “hush, hush,” we had heard whispers about it from other moms who had been there. We had an idea of what to expect, but still we were not prepared. Gather 150 young men of seventeen and eighteen years on a hot and humid May day, dress them up in their finest attire, stuff them into a crowded, non-air-conditioned auditorium to sit beside their moms for more than three hours. It’s bound to be interesting.
